Common Integration Use Cases Between Amplience Dynamic Content and 3Play Media

Amplience Dynamic Content is a headless content management and digital experience platform used to create, manage, and deliver personalized content across web, mobile, and commerce channels. 3Play Media provides media accessibility and localization services such as transcription, captioning, subtitling, audio description, and translation workflows for video and audio content. Together, they support a scalable content operation where rich media can be produced, localized, made accessible, and published through a centralized digital experience layer.

1. Automated Caption and Transcript Ingestion into Content Experiences

Data flow: 3Play Media to Amplience Dynamic Content

When video assets are processed in 3Play Media, captions and transcripts can be automatically pushed into Amplience Dynamic Content as structured content fields or linked media metadata. This allows content teams to publish videos with accurate captions and searchable transcripts without manual file handling.

  • Improves accessibility compliance across digital channels
  • Reduces manual upload and formatting work for content teams
  • Enables faster publishing of video-rich campaigns and product pages

2. Localization Workflow for Multilingual Video Content

Data flow: Amplience Dynamic Content to 3Play Media and back to Amplience Dynamic Content

Amplience can send video references, campaign context, and locale requirements to 3Play Media for subtitling or translation. Once completed, localized caption files and translated transcripts can be returned to Amplience and associated with the correct regional content variants.

  • Supports global content rollouts with consistent messaging
  • Reduces coordination between marketing, localization, and production teams
  • Helps regional teams publish approved localized media faster

3. Accessible Product Detail Pages with Embedded Video Metadata

Data flow: 3Play Media to Amplience Dynamic Content

For ecommerce teams using Amplience to manage product detail pages, 3Play Media can supply captions, transcripts, and accessibility metadata for product demo videos, tutorials, and how-to content. Amplience then renders these assets alongside product content to improve usability and compliance.

  • Enhances product discovery and engagement
  • Supports accessibility requirements for digital commerce
  • Improves SEO through transcript-based content indexing

4. Centralized Approval Workflow for Media Accessibility Assets

Data flow: Bi-directional

Amplience can trigger the creation of accessibility tasks in 3Play Media when a new video asset is added to a campaign or page. 3Play Media can return status updates such as in progress, ready for review, or approved. This gives content operations teams visibility into media readiness before publishing.

  • Creates a controlled workflow for compliance review
  • Prevents publishing delays caused by missing captions or transcripts
  • Improves cross-team accountability between content and accessibility teams
